Workshop Topics

We customize every session to suit your grade level (Grades 3-12) and school goals.

  • Tech Use, Social Media, and Mental Health

    We explore the emotional impact of being “always on,” helping students reflect on their digital habits, understand how tech affects their mood and self-image, and learn strategies for healthy screen use and digital boundaries.

  • Self-Worth in the Age of Likes and Filters

    This workshop helps students build an authentic sense of self in a world full of highlight reels. We tackle the pressures of perfectionism, social comparison, and self-doubt, and empower students to tune into their strengths and values — not just their follower count.

  • Balancing School, Sports, and Life

    For high-achievers and busy students, this session is a game-changer. We teach students how to spot the signs of burnout, create space for recovery, and set realistic boundaries around commitments, without the guilt.

  • How to Take Back Control

    From spiraling thoughts to test anxiety, students learn concrete tools to manage worry, stay grounded in high-stress moments, and interrupt the loop of overthinking before it takes over.

  • Connection in a Disconnected World

    We give students the tools to communicate clearly, navigate conflict, and build stronger peer relationships — online and off. This session fosters emotional intelligence and helps students practice empathy, boundaries, and authentic connection.
